Mucovisc 600mg Tablet 10s
ACETYLCYSTEINE
Introduction to Mucovisc 600mg Tablet 10s
Mucovisc 600mg Tablet 10s is a medication primarily used to treat acetaminophen overdose and respiratory conditions with thick mucus. This medicine is available in tablet form and is designed to help alleviate symptoms associated with these conditions.
Composition of Mucovisc 600mg Tablet 10s
The active ingredient in Mucovisc 600mg Tablet 10s is acetylcysteine. Acetylcysteine works by replenishing glutathione, a substance that aids the liver in processing acetaminophen safely, and by breaking down mucus in the lungs, making it easier to breathe.
Uses of Mucovisc 600mg Tablet 10s
- Treatment of acetaminophen overdose
- Management of respiratory conditions with thick mucus
Side effects of Mucovisc 600mg Tablet 10s
- Nausea
- Vomiting
- Rash
Precautions of Mucovisc 600mg Tablet 10s
Do not use Mucovisc 600mg Tablet 10s if you are allergic to acetylcysteine. Serious allergic reactions can cause rash, hives, or swelling that makes breathing difficult. Use caution if you have asthma, as it may affect breathing.
How to Take Mucovisc 600mg Tablet 10s
Mucovisc 600mg Tablet 10s is usually taken orally. The dosage depends on the condition being treated. For acetaminophen overdose, it is often administered in a hospital setting. For respiratory issues, it is taken at home as directed by your doctor.
